Veggie Garden

As we know that vegetables are good for health. Sometimes we try to avoid vegetables in diet. School going childrens they like fast food, street food and unhygienic food. If we serve them in an artistic way definitely they will show the interest of eating vegetables. The garden is made by mashed potatoes and green vegetables. This recipe is similar to salad. It is cooked, just cut and start eating.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ings 4

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cup mashed potatoes
  • 1/4 cup grated carrot
  • 1/4 cup grated beetroot
  • 1/4 cup grated cabbage
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on powder
  • 1 tsp roasted cumin powder
  • 1 tsp garlic paste
  • 1 tsp Ginger paste
  • 1/2 ginger powder
  • 1 tsp black pepper powder
  • 50 gm butter
  • Cut the veggies with design for garnishing
Advertisement

Instructions
 

  • Take a frying pan add butter, grated cabbage, grated carrot and beetroot, ginger garlic paste.
  • Stir continuously there should not any moisture. Add cinnamon powder, roasted cumin powder, black pepper powder and salt. Mix all together then keep aside.
  • In the same pan add butter, mashed potatoes, ginger powder and salt. Saute and mix properly.
  • I have given a hut shaped and flower pot.
  • Take a serving plate put the cooked vegetables and cover with cooked potatoes. Flower pot also in same way.
  • Garnish with designer cut vegetables, spring onion and mint.
